    Coding from Home 3 webinar 

    The project was presented in Coding from home 3: Remote robotics, 21-day coding challenge and computer science education in Croatia on the agenda of the webinar.
    https://blog.codeweek.eu/…/coding-from-home-3-remote-roboti…

    Around 50 participants from Belgium, Croatia, Estonia, Greece, Italy, Luxembourg, North Macedonia, Portugal, Sweden and Tunisia took part in the 3rd Coding from Home webinar on 6 April 2020.
